Subject: [PATCH v2] ARM: msm: Move msm_timer to CLOCKSOURCE_OF_DECLARE
Date: Mon, 17 Jun 2013 10:30:59 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1371490259-13495-1-git-send-email-sboyd@codeaurora.org> (raw)
This allows us to remove the init_time callback in the DT machine
descriptors, shrinking the code.
Signed-off-by: Stephen Boyd <sboyd@codeaurora.org>
---
Changes since v1:
* Added CLKSRC_OF selection
arch/arm/Kconfig | 1 +
ar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8660.c | 1 -
ar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8960.c | 1 -
arch/arm/mach-msm/common.h | 1 -
arch/arm/mach-msm/timer.c | 17 +++--------------
5 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 17 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m/Kconfig b/arch/arm/Kconfig
index d423d58..96fe140 100644
--- a/arch/arm/Kconfig
+++ b/arch/arm/Kconfig
@@ -622,6 +622,7 @@ config ARCH_MSM
bool "Qualcomm MSM"
select ARCH_REQUIRE_GPIOLIB
select CLKDEV_LOOKUP
+ select CLKSRC_OF if OF
select GENERIC_CLOCKEVENTS
select HAVE_CLK
help
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8660.c b/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8660.c
index 7dcfc53..4bd22ca 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8660.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8660.c
@@ -47,6 +47,5 @@ DT_MACHINE_START(MSM_DT, "Qualcomm MSM (Flattened Device Tree)")
.init_irq = irqchip_init,
.init_machine = msm8x60_dt_init,
.init_late = msm8x60_init_late,
- .init_time = msm_dt_timer_init,
.dt_compat = msm8x60_fluid_match,
MACHINE_END
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8960.c b/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8960.c
index 7301936..9a2b525 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8960.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-msm/board-dt-8960.c
@@ -32,7 +32,6 @@ DT_MACHINE_START(MSM8960_DT, "Qualcomm MSM (Flattened Device Tree)")
.smp = smp_ops(msm_smp_ops),
.map_io = msm_map_msm8960_io,
.init_irq = irqchip_init,
- .init_time = msm_dt_timer_init,
.init_machine = msm_dt_init,
.dt_compat = msm8960_dt_match,
MACHINE_END
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-msm/common.h b/arch/arm/mach-msm/common.h
index ce8215a..e32429e 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-msm/common.h
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-msm/common.h
@@ -14,7 +14,6 @@
extern void msm7x01_timer_init(void);
extern void msm7x30_timer_init(void);
-extern void msm_dt_timer_init(void);
extern void qsd8x50_timer_init(void);
extern void msm_map_common_io(void);
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-msm/timer.c b/arch/arm/mach-msm/timer.c
index 284313f..1167cf6 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-msm/timer.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-msm/timer.c
@@ -219,15 +219,8 @@ err:
}
#ifdef CONFIG_OF
-static const struct of_device_id msm_timer_match[] __initconst = {
- { .compatible = "qcom,kpss-timer" },
- { .compatible = "qcom,scss-timer" },
- { },
-};
-
-void __init msm_dt_timer_init(void)
+static void __init msm_dt_timer_init(struct device_node *np)
{
- struct device_node *np;
u32 freq;
int irq;
struct resource res;
@@ -235,12 +228,6 @@ void __init msm_dt_timer_init(void)
void __iomem *base;
void __iomem *cpu0_base;
- np = of_find_matching_node(NULL, msm_timer_match);
- if (!np) {
- pr_err("Can't find msm timer DT node\n");
- return;
- }
-
base = of_iomap(np, 0);
if (!base) {
pr_err("Failed to map event base\n");
@@ -283,6 +270,8 @@ void __init msm_dt_timer_init(void)
msm_timer_init(freq, 32, irq, !!percpu_offset);
}
+CLOCKSOURCE_OF_DECLARE(kpss_timer, "qcom,kpss-timer", msm_dt_timer_init);
+CLOCKSOURCE_OF_DECLARE(scss_timer, "qcom,scss-timer", msm_dt_timer_init);
#endif
